KZN murder-accused must be denied bail: victim's mom
Updated | By Anelisa Kubheka
Members of the Right to Know Campaign will picket outside the Pietermaritzburg High Court today where an Eshowe farmer is expected to apply for bail.
The accused has been charged with the murder of a 13-year-old boy. He allegedly ran over the boy with his vehicle in 2014.
According to Right to Know, the farmer had initially been charged with reckless driving and hadn't been arrested until they intervened.
The campaign wants the accused to be denied bail. The mother of the boy, Lindiwe Khanyile says her son would have started high school this year.
"It's better he doesn't get bail because he's caused so much damage. I wish him nothing but hurt as well like he caused hurt to me," she said.
